Classic Sneaker That Shaped the Industry

The history of casual sneaker is marked by iconic designs. These designs have influenced not only sneaker culture but also fashion at large. Here are a few classic sneakers that have become staples in the industry:

  • Chuck Taylor All-Stars: Introduced by Converse, these sneakers are timeless. They began as basketball shoes and grew into casual wear favorites.
  • Adidas Stan Smith: Named after the tennis star, Stan Smiths are known for their minimalist look. They blend sport with style seamlessly.
  • Nike Air Force 1: This classic has been around since the 80s. It’s a must-have for sneaker aficionados and remains a symbol of street style.
  • Puma Suede: With its sleek design and comfort, the Puma Suede remains popular. It’s often associated with breakdancing and hip-hop culture.
  • Vans Old Skool: A skateboarding original, these casual sneakers are famous for their durable design and iconic side stripe.

These models set the groundwork for today’s casual sneaker trends. They prove that good design withstands the test of time. How to Choose the Right Casual Sneaker for Your Style

Choosing the right casual sneaker can be daunting. With endless options, you need a game plan. Start by assessing your everyday style. Are you bold and expressive, or do you prefer timeless classics? This can guide your sneaker choice. Next, consider comfort. Opt for sneakers with good support and cushioning. Remember, the best casual sneaker fits well and feels great.

Look at the materials, too. Leather may offer durability, whereas mesh provides breathability. Color is key for matching with your wardrobe. Neutral tones are versatile, while bright colors make a statement. Also, factor in your lifestyle. Office workers might want sleek, low-profile sneakers. Outdoor enthusiasts could use something sturdier.

Lastly, think of the occasion. For casual outings, chunkier and bold designs fit the bill. For more formal settings, go minimal and subdued. Stick to these tips and find the perfect casual sneaker for your style.

Caring for Your Casual Sneaker

Maintaining your casual sneaker ensures they last longer and stay in good shape. Follow these simple steps to keep your sneakers looking fresh:

  • Clean Regularly: Dirt can quickly accumulate, making sneakers look dull. Wipe down your sneakers with a damp cloth after each wear. Use a soft-bristled brush for tougher stains.
  • Remove Odors: Sneakers can develop unpleasant smells. Place baking soda inside overnight to absorb odors. In the morning, shake out any excess baking soda.
  • Store Properly: Keep sneakers in a cool, dry place to prevent damage. Avoid keeping them in direct sunlight or damp areas.
  • Spot Treatment: Address spills and stains immediately. Gently pat the area with a cloth soaked in a mixture of water and mild detergent.
  • Dry Naturally: Wet sneakers should air dry at room temperature. Don’t put them near heaters or use a dryer, as high heat can warp the shape.
  • Rotate Wear: Don’t wear the same pair every day. Alternating between sneakers gives them time to air out and reduces wear and tear.

Caring for your casual sneaker doesn’t take much effort but can greatly extend their lifespan. Remember, clean sneakers reflect on your overall style and care for your attire.

Sustainability and Ethical Fashion in the Sneaker World

The sneaker world is not just about style and comfort anymore. It is also leading the way in sustainability and ethical fashion. As the world becomes more eco-conscious, brands are stepping up. They are now incorporating eco-friendly materials and ethical practices. Here is how the casual sneaker industry is making a difference:

  • Eco-friendly Materials: Many brands are using recycled plastics to make their sneakers. This reduces waste and the need for new raw materials. Organic cotton and natural rubber are also popular.
  • Ethical Production: Companies are looking at how their sneakers are made. They aim for fair labor practices and safe working conditions. Some even partner with factories that provide fair wages.
  • Vegan Options: The demand for animal-free products is growing. Brands now offer vegan sneakers made without any animal products.
  • Reducing Carbon Footprint: Efforts to lessen environmental impact are key. Some brands are cutting down on emissions during production. Others use renewable energy sources.
  • Repurposing Sneakers: Innovative programs allow customers to return worn sneakers. Brands then recycle them into new products or donate to those in need.
  • Transparent Supply Chains: Companies are sharing where and how their products are made. This openness builds trust and ensures accountability. It also helps consumers make informed choices.
